The Moinian Group Completes Ownership of 3 Columbus Circle

-- Moinian closes on deal with SL Green to finalize 100% stake in iconic Columbus Circle office building --

NEW YORK--()--The Moinian Group today announced that they have closed on its deal with SL Green to complete its full ownership of 3 Columbus Circle, the iconic office building that also houses Moinian’s headquarters.

In 2011, The Moinian Group first partnered with SL Green on 3 Columbus Circle, which was formerly known as the Newsweek Building and originally built as the General Motors Corporation’s headquarters. The 26-story Class-A office building is located on Broadway just across the street from Time Warner Center, with expansive views of Central Park.

In 2012, together with renowned architect Gensler, The Moinian Group oversaw a complete renovation of the building, including the design of a new facade and lobby. The modernization of 3 Columbus Circle helped quickly lease up the building to 100% and it continues to remain fully leased. The building’s current roster of office tenants includes VMLY&R and Versace USA. Nordstrom occupies a portion of the retail space on the ground floor.

With completion of the new agreement, Moinian assumes full ownership of 3 Columbus Circle.
